Intlvac Thermal Vacuum System
Intlvac’s Thermal Vacuum System is a versatile space simulation
system, with a vacuum chamber constructed from 304 stainless steel,
measuring either 36” x 36” (.9m x .9m) or 59” x 78”
(1.5m x 2m). The chambers are designed to provide an extensive
environmental test complex to simulate the outer space and varying
thermal conditions. It allows for a variety of parts to be tested in
a <10-6 torr vacuum, in a dry pumped, clean environment.
Each chamber is fitted with either a turbo pumping system or cryogenic
pumping system. Multiple thermocouples and a readout system are
included for monitoring items under test.
Intlvac’s fully automated PLC system controls all pump-down
venting, cryopump regeneration cycles, and also allows researchers
the option of manual operation. Efficient isolation between
the thermal simulation shroud, and the high vacuum chamber, assists
and controls stability and temperature rates.
LabVIEW software is used as the computer operating system and is
expandable to meet the user’s needs. A Polycold refrigeration
unit is used for platen cooling. A series of cartridge type
heaters are used for heating. The temperature control is
accomplished using a full PID controller, allowing for temperature
ramping and soaking.
